Avoid spending lots of money before closing day on the mortgage. Lenders tend to run another credit check before closing, and could change their mind if too much activity is noticed. Wait until after you have closed on your mortgage before running out for major purchases.
Pay down the debt that you already have and don’t get new debt when you start working with a home mortgage. The lower your debt is, the higher a mortgage loan you can qualify for. If you are carrying too much debt, lenders may just turn you away. Carrying debt may also cost you a lot of money by increasing your mortgage rate.

You should have a work history that shows how long you’ve been working if you wish to get a home mortgage. Many lenders insist that you show them two work years that are steady in order to approve your loan. Too many job changes can hurt your chances of being approved. Quitting your job during the loan approval process is not a good idea.

If you struggle to pay off your mortgage, seek out help. Counseling might help if you cannot stay on top of your monthly payments or are struggling. There are various agencies that offer counseling under HUD offices around the country. These counselors who have been approved by HUD offer free advice that will show you prevent your home from being foreclosed. Call HUD office to find out about local programs.
If you have never bought a home before, check into government programs. These programs can help with the cost of closing, finding the best rates, and even assist in finding lenders that can help people with lower credit ratings.

When mortgage brokers are looking at your credit report, it is more beneficial to have low balances on several different accounts than it is to have a large balance on one or two credit cards. Try to have balances that are lower than 50 percent of the credit limit you’re working with. If you can get them under thirty percent, that’s even better.
If you do not have a good credit score, try to save a substantial down payment in advance of applying. It is common for people to save between three and five percent, you’ll want to have about 20 percent saved as a way to better your chances of loan approval.
